Polyurethane for this should have a higher hardness of 80 to 90 Shore A, though the height of 25 cm is not that high but a higher density of 40-50 lbs/ft³ density range should be able to protect the 121 lbs product. A foam with a lesser compression will be able to protect the product.
You may go with EPS (Expanded Polystyrene), EPS should also give a good compressive strength, and it can be moulded as per the shape and it will be good for transit. You may have to conduct ECT and BCT.
I hope you considering an ASTM (ASTM D4169, D5276, D3332) standard for testing. An ISTA 1A with ASTM should give you a comprehensive result.
